    One kg of a diatomic gas is at a pressure of \[8\times {{10}^{4}}N/{{m}^{2}}.\] The density of the gas is\[4\text{ }kg/{{m}^{3}}\]. What is the energy of the gas due to its thermal motion?     AIEEE  Solved  Paper-2009

    A) \[3\times {{10}^{4}}J\]                  

    B) \[5\times {{10}^{4}}J\]  

    C)        \[6\times {{10}^{4}}J\]  

    D)        \[7\times {{10}^{4}}J.\]

    Correct Answer: B

    Solution :
